RagnarDa Posted July 11, 2012 Posted July 11, 2012 I think i figured out a workaround for this meanwhile we are waiting for the patch. When having the target in the sight, first wait for the aircraft to stop oscillate. Then put the target in the lower half of the targeting circle. This will ensure when you launch the missile it will catch the laser beam imediately after launch. When you have launched the missile will travel slightly under the laser beam, therefore compensate by diving a bit or just put the target in the upper half of the targeting circle. After compensating for a second or two, keep the target centered in the target circle and keep stable until impact. You should also check the windspeed in the mission as the Vikhrs seems useless in strong winds. This seems to work OK for me, hope it helps someone. I have tested it some more and it seems better to keep the target at, or directly under, your datum (the cross) in the HUD. This seems to keep the missile going almost straight, especially in a fast steep dive. On some runs it doesn't seem to matter what you do, the missiles just decides to go in the ground halfway there. RagnarDa Posted July 11, 2012 Posted July 11, 2012 (edited) Since the Toad dont have a flight path marker on the HUD, it would be interesting to know the correct AoA you should have when guiding the Vikhr inside the targeting-circle. I can't find anything in the FC2 manual, anyone know this? I took it upon myself to calculate this. From the very first picture in this thread I could tell that the launch angle of the Vikhr was quite exactly 2 degrees below the correct angle. Judging from the HUD the launch angle, or center of the aiming-circle, should be about 10 degrees below the aircrafts horizontal axis. This is confirmed by Boberros third picture, where the missile should fly to the vertical center of the HUD at about 3 degrees below the center of the circle. His AoA is about 6 degrees which would lead us to think he should guide his missile by putting the target just below the top of the aiming circle. Hope its OK Boberro that I drew a little on your picture to show what I mean: And yes, I AM quoting myself in two posts in a row... :wacko: EDIT: After a lot of more testing, I've noticed that the best way to guide the missile is to put the target above the cross/horizontal plane. In FC2's Su-25T I would usually only have one or two Vikhr's out of sixteen lose lock and drop right away, and get hits on the rest. With DCS' Su-25T, it seems 50% of the Vikhr's lose lock and drop right away, and of the remaining eight about two or three fall short and hit the dirt just before the target. I've found I have to come in at a much higher angle to avoid the Vikhr's hitting short, but the ~50% losing lock issue unfortunately seems to be there regardless of the approach angle/altitude.
